Output 6112627b0ea2fa3a484e5fae8a81bf37c8d071ceb7044992fea1d69fbbeb3330:2

value
17740680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042784b78fd9122a3349e61ea3beda7504b371ae OP_EQUAL
address
324yy6inoLQsanpAqExwziK4uJuHNgatEA
transaction
6112627b0ea2fa3a484e5fae8a81bf37c8d071ceb7044992fea1d69fbbeb3330
spent
true